Qualcomm WCD9380/WCD9385 Codec is a standalone Hi-Fi audio codec IC
connected over SoundWire. This device has two SoundWire device RX and
TX respectively, supporting 4 x ADCs, ClassH, Ear, Aux PA, 2xHPH,
7 x TX diff inputs, 8 DMICs, MBHC.

If we write registers very fast we can endup in a situation where some
of the writes will be dropped without any notice.
So wait for the fifo space to be available before reading/writing the
soundwire registers.

NPL clock rate is twice the MCLK rate, so set this correctly to
avoid soundwire timeouts.

Common consumer schemas need to use the base.yaml meta-schema because
they need to define different constraints (e.g. the type) from what
users of the common schema need to define (e.g. how many entries).
